2009-12-03 57 views
169

如何在git log的輸出中顯示分支的名稱?如何在`git log`中顯示分支的名稱?

例如,git log --graph --all我對提交有一個很好的概述,但弄糊塗哪一行是主控,哪個是我的分支。

+1

有用的,顯示鏈接頭或標籤的名稱似乎已經默認完成,因爲一些最近的'git'更新。 – 2017-08-02 10:29:12

回答

259

嘗試裝飾選項。

git log --graph --all --decorate 

它標註標籤或分支指向的提交。

+2

但是,它不會使用'--pretty = format'選項進行堆棧。 – 2009-12-03 17:32:16

+34

使用'--pretty',您可以在'裝飾'處使用'%d'。 – 2009-12-03 17:41:17

+0

我有這個'git lg'別名,現在這個作品太棒了! – vdboor 2012-02-27 11:37:28